Abstract

An absorbent article such as infant training pants is provided with a mechanical hook-and-loop type fastening system in which at least the loop material is made of a laminate with a facing having a bond density of greater than 225 points per square inch.

Claims (20)

1. A mechanical fastening system for an article, said mechanical fastening system comprising:

a stretchable loop fastener component mountable on the article and comprising a stretch bonded laminate, said stretch bonded laminate comprising an elastomeric substrate and a high bond point nonwoven loop material having greater than 225 bond points per square inch; and

a hook fastener component mountable on the article and adapted for releasable engagement with the loop fastener component;

wherein the stretchable loop fastener component is stretchable relative to the hook fastener component when the fastener components are engaged.

2. The mechanical fastening system of claim 1 wherein the stretchable loop fastener component can be elastically stretched at least 100 percent in at least one direction.

3. The mechanical fastening system of claim 1 wherein the high bond point nonwoven loop material has a bond area of greater than 10 percent.

4. The mechanical fastening system of claim 3 wherein the high bond point nonwoven loop material has a bond area of greater than 20 percent.

5. The mechanical fastening system of claim 4 wherein the high bond point nonwoven loop material has a bond area of greater than 30 percent.

6. The mechanical fastening system of claim 1 wherein the high bond point nonwoven loop material has at least 250 bond points per square inch.

7. The mechanical fastening system of claim 6 wherein the high bond point nonwoven loop material has a bond area of greater than 20 percent.

8. The mechanical fastening system of claim 7 wherein the high bond point nonwoven loop material has a bond area of greater than 30 percent.

9. The mechanical fastening system of claim 1 wherein the high bond point nonwoven loop material has at least 275 bond points per square inch.

10. The mechanical fastening system of claim 9 wherein the high bond point nonwoven loop material has a bond area of greater than 20 percent.

11. The mechanical fastening system of claim 10 wherein the high bond point nonwoven loop material has a bond area of greater than 30 percent.

12. The mechanical fastening system of claim 1 wherein the high bond point nonwoven loop material is mechanically prestrained.

13. The mechanical fastening system of claim 12 wherein the high bond point nonwoven loop material is neck-stretched.

14. The mechanical fastening system of claim 1 wherein the high bond point nonwoven loop material has at least 300 bond points per square inch and a bond area of greater than 10 percent.

15. The mechanical fastening system of claim 14 wherein the high bond point nonwoven loop material has a bond area of greater than 20 percent.

16. The mechanical fastening system of claim 15 wherein the high bond point nonwoven loop material has a bond area of greater than 30 percent.
